Ultimate Guide to Choosing the Right Bicycle for You
Understanding Your Needs
Before you start searching for the perfect bicycle, ask yourself: What will you use your bike for? Commuting, exercise, touring, or simply recreation? The answer will significantly narrow down your options. If you need a bike for daily commutes, a city bike or folding bike would be ideal. If you’re passionate about conquering challenging terrains, a mountain bike is the perfect choice.
Popular Types of Bicycles
1. Mountain Bikes:
Designed to tackle rough terrain, mountain bikes feature sturdy frames, thick tires, and effective suspension systems. There are various types of mountain bikes, from hardtail to full-suspension bikes.
2. Road Bikes:
Lightweight and fast, road bikes are ideal for long-distance cycling on paved surfaces. They typically have lightweight frames, thin tires, and a sporty riding position.
3. City Bikes:
Suitable for city commuting, city bikes usually have an upright, comfortable design and often come equipped with baskets or racks for carrying items.
4. Folding Bikes:
Convenient for transport and storage, folding bikes can be easily folded and carried on public transport.
5. Hybrid Bikes:
Combining features of road bikes and city bikes, hybrid bikes are versatile and suitable for various terrains.
Factors to Consider When Choosing a Bicycle
Frame: The frame material (steel, aluminum, carbon) affects the bike’s weight, durability, and price.Wheels: Wheel size impacts speed and off-road capabilities.Drivetrain: The number of gears and the drivetrain brand affect cycling performance.Brakes: Disc brakes or rim brakes, braking performance affects safety.Price: Your budget will be a crucial factor in your final decision. Carefully weigh quality and cost.
Test Ride Before You Buy
The most important thing is to test ride before you buy. Visit a bike shop to test various bike types and find the one that best suits your physique and needs. Ensure the bike fits you comfortably.
